# Swiss-knife MCP server It allows searching(`search` tool) for the Model Context Protocol servers using MCP [registry](https://github.com/modelcontextprotocol/registry). Once your AI agent has found the MCP server that it needs, it can add it to the configuration using `add_mcp_server` tool. You will get new tools after restarting the MCP server. ## Available tools * `mcp_configuration` - shows current MCP configuration * `search` - search for the MCP server using the index based on the MCP registry * `add_mcp_server` - adds configuration for the MCP server * `remove_mcp_server` - removes configuration for the MCP server * `refresh_mcp_index` - refreshes the MCP index * ... all other tools will be based on the added MCP servers ## Configuration Sample configuration: ``` { "mcpServers": { "Universal MCP Server": { "command": "npx", "args": ["-y", "@antonytm/mcp-all@latest"], "transport": "stdio", "environmentVariables": [ { "name": "TRANSPORT", "value": "stdio" } ] } } } ``` It supports `stdio` and `streamable-http` transports. ## Release Released as: * [NPM package](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@antonytm/mcp-all) * [Docker image](https://hub.docker.com/repository/docker/antonytm/mcp-all/general)
